摘要
The construct of social privilege is ubiquitous within the multicultural and social justice literature. However, the group work literature has yet to integrate the construct into group theory, processes, and training. In this article, we review the group literature on multicultural and diversity issues. Also, we examine the multicultural and social justice literature for an operational definition of social privilege. Finally, we make an argument for the impact of social privilege on group work and for the necessity of integrating social justice competencies into group work.
